AutoCAD 3DMAX C语言 Pro/E UG JAVA编程 PHP编程 Maya动画 Matlab应用 Android
Photoshop Word Excel flash VB编程 VC编程 Coreldraw SolidWorks A Designer Unity3D
 首页 > JavaScript

JS中获取函数调用链所有参数的方法

51自学网 http://www.wanshiok.com
JS,函数,调用链,所有参数
function getCallerArgument(){  var result = [];  var slice = Array.prototype.slice;  var caller = arguments.callee.caller;  while(caller){    result = result.concat(slice.call(caller.arguments, 0));    caller = caller.arguments.callee.caller;  }  return result;};var a = function(){b('a1','a2')}, b = function(){b('b1','b2')},c= function(){return getCallerArgument()};c('c1');


JS,函数,调用链,所有参数  
上一篇:ECMAScript5(ES5)中bind方法使用小结  下一篇:jQuery中animate动画第二次点击事件没反应